Description
One of two delightful shepherds huts set in a 5 acre working smallholding with fabulous views over open countryside and working farmland towards Eryri / Snowdonia. Bryn (Hill in Welsh) has a fixed kingsize bed. The huts are warm and cosy with heating, their own en-suite showers and gas cookers. The huts suit adult couples or solo travellers, looking for a quiet break. Each hut has its own firepit and BBQ, outdoor seating and blankets so you can sit and stargaze on a clear night. The space The two huts are situated 50 yards apart, making them private spaces, but they are close enough together for someone looking for a holiday with friends. You can park your car and take a short walk down the hill to the hut! To get Bryn into position with a good view, we created a bank for it to sit on. This does mean that there is a steep slope just outside the hut – so you’re welcome to use a flat clearing on top of the hill where you will find a picnic table. Wellies are advised if it's wet! Guest access Down the hill from Bryn there is a small field which is a wildlife haven with a pond, which you are welcome to explore and walk your dog around.
